Ekurhuleni shares in the joy on Christmas babies

Christmas Day is a time for exchanging gifts and, some mothers gave birth to more precious gifts on this special day.

The Member of Mayoral Committee (MMC) for Health and Social Services, Cllr Makhosazana Mabaso, spent her time visiting Natalspruit Hospital in Vosloorus, Bertha Gxowa Hospital in Germiston and Tambo Memorial Hospital in Boksburg to welcome the Christmas babies, bringing along goodies for the bundles of joy.

Thirteen new born babies from the three hospitals received their first gifts from the City of Ekurhuleni. The gift packs included Ekurhuleni branded bathtubs, baby blankets and baby products.

Speaking to their mothers, Mabaso said, “I wish the children good health, and those who are not with their mothers to get better soon so they can be reconnected with their mothers.”

She further urged the mothers to breastfeed and take good care of their children.

The MMC also welcomed babies born on New Year’s Day at Pholosong Hospital followed by followed by Far East Rand and Tembisa hospitals.
